Transaction 4e932a4fa815b0565195a8ed5921d13486612e15b678c38da600a260b74084c3
1 Input
1 Output
-
4e932a4fa815b0565195a8ed5921d13486612e15b678c38da600a260b74084c3:0
- value
- 528504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d33edb5e2bcf4633ff0070fe23d372664e111ae OP_EQUAL
- address
- 38jEANebkzhmNqv98xdWD1sysvHvvTTiGC